Aesthetic Touches for Space! Get an extra 10% off at checkout on Home Decoration Category, when you buy 2 or more!

Mother Nature

designer

Mother Nature

4 Products

It is a brand that stands out with its products made from completely natural plants, born in Austria. Currently, it has sales throughout Europe and the products are mainly produced in Germany with special certification.